— used to say that you have little or no knowledge of something说不定;不知道
For all I know, he left last night. [=I don't know when he left; it's possible that he left last night]说不定他昨晚就走了。
She may have already accepted another job, for all we know. [=we don't know what she has done; it's possible that she has already accepted another job]我们不清楚,也许她已经接受了另一份工作。
